Abstract

Many problems are related to physics, engineering, biology, and other ap plied sciences, leading to modeling phenomena in the form of integral equa tions. The aim of this thesis is to study nonlinear integral equations: classifica tions, existenceanduniquenessofthesolutionusingtheBanachfixedpoint,and obtaining numerical solutions by using the successive approximations method, Nyströmmethod,projectionmethods,andspecificallyhighlightthewaveletmethod. All the methods used and examined for the numerical solution of nonlinear in tegral equations. Moreover, this method reduces the integral equations to sys tems of nonlinear algebraic equations that can be solved by Newton’s method. Wealso estimate the error bounds and convergence of the presented methods. Using Mathematica10.3software, several numerical examples are mentionedto demonstrate its effectiveness and accuracy in solving nonlinear integral equa tions, specifically the type of nonlinear quadratic integral equations. .
